HOW TO CHARGE
1. Connect the charger to the battery.
For batteries mounted inside a vehicle
1. Connect the charger according to the
vehicles manual.
2. Connect the charger to the wall socket.
3. Disconnect the charger from the wall socket
before disconnecting the battery.
4. Disconnect the black clamp before the red
clamp.
1 2
2. Connect the charger to the wall socket. The power lamp will indicate that the mains
cable is connected to the wall socket. The power lamp will blink if the battery clamps
are incorrectly connected. The reverse polarity protection will ensure that the battery or
charger will not be damaged.

3. Press the MODE-button to select charging program.
NORMAL BATTERY PROGRAM LITHIUM BATTERY PROGRAM
Continue to press the MODE-button to combine charging program with charging options.
RECOND OPTION
Press the MODE-button several times until the desired combination of charging program
and options are lit.
4. Follow the display through the charging process.
The battery is fully charged when the CARE lamp is lit.
5. Stop charging at any time by disconnecting the mains cable from the wall socket.

Lead-Acid Charging Steps

Step 1: Desulphation

Removes sulphate from lead plates using pulsing current and voltage.

Step 2: Soft Start

Tests the battery's ability to accept charge.

Step 3: Bulk Charging

Charges at maximum current until approximately 80% capacity.

Step 4: Absorption Charging

Charges with declining current to reach 100% capacity.

Step 5: Analyze

Tests if the battery can hold charge.

Step 6: Recond

Increases voltage for controlled gassing to mix battery acid.

Step 7: Float Charging

Maintains battery voltage with a constant charge.

Step 8: Pulse Maintenance

Maintains 95-100% capacity with pulsed charging.
